Microsoft Visual Studio MSDN subscription gives one the full charge of their PC and enhances their business experience in virtually getting almost everything done through this subscription. The subscription not just comes with Visual Studio Tools for Office but it also gives one access to Visual Studio Codename Orcas Visual SourceSafe, Visual Studio.net, Visual Basic, Visual C, Visual C++, Visual J, and Visual FoxPro.

Adding to the subscription list is operating systems from Windows Vista (Ultimate/Enterprise/Business/Home, or Premium Home/Basic) to Windows XP (XP Professional/Home/Media Center Edition Table PC Edition) and Microsoft Office 2007 tools such as Word, Excel, Power Point, Outlook, Access etc.

The list goes on to add      Office Publisher, Office OneNote, Office InfoPath, Office Communicator, Office SharePoint Designer, Office Groove, Office Visio, Office Project Standard, Office Accounting, Office Business Scorecard Manager, Office FrontPage, MapPoint, Office Project Professional, Office Project Portfolio Server, and Office Project Server. One even gets access to financial tools such as Dynamics CRM, Small Business Accounting and Point of Sale. 

On the server front, with a premium MSDN subscription, one gets access to Windows Server, 2003 R2, Windows Service codename Longhorn, and Compute Cluster, Windows SharePoint Services, and Windows Services for UNIX and a whole lot of bunch so that one takes full charge of their business operations.
